On Tue, 17 Feb 2026 00:09:45 +0800
Chen-Yu Tsai <wens at kernel.org> wrote:
> After commit e623c4303ed1 ("gpiolib: sanitize the return value of
> gpio_chip::get_direction()"), a warning will be printed if the
> gpio driver does not implement this callback.
I am curious how this could slip through? Did the get_direction()
callback become mandatory at one point, but no one noticed that it was
missing for sunxi? It looks like the situation was even worse before that
patch, as it was dereferencing the function pointer without any check?
> Implement it for the sunxi driver. This is simply a matter of reading
> out the mux value from the registers, then checking if it is one of
> the GPIO functions and which direction it is.
Mmh, it feels a bit backwards to resort to the function name *string* for
comparison, when it's always 0 for in and 1 for out (which we actually set
in pinctrl-sunxi-dt.c now). But the mux value for IRQ is different between
SoC generations, and I guess for historic reasons function strings are a
thing in pinctrl, so this is probably the best solution after all:
